Output 6fb8b95a58f21b64295eb2fa757478df20ec1840d8e23f9edb06788f43da5679:0

value
763934649
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 02306f443b7851e3f723260303836d3e9169def8 OP_EQUALVERIFY OP_CHECKSIG
address
1CaNgWBzAHKjRH91JTvZSWCqdXdsxTzB4
transaction
6fb8b95a58f21b64295eb2fa757478df20ec1840d8e23f9edb06788f43da5679
spent
true